Not illustrated. 1899 edition. Excerpt: ... II. THE JURISDICTION AND PROCEDURE OF THE CHANCERY DIVISION. The jurisdiction and procedure of the Chancery Division may be treated under the following heads: --(1) Actions for general administration--(a) Begun by writ, (6) Begun by originating summons; (2) Special kinds of relief given chiefly by originating summons; (3) Insolvent estates. It is proposed in the first place to describe, in all its stages, an action for general administration begun by writ. The procedure in such an action is the rule: other forms of procedure are exceptions to or modifications of it. 1. Act1ons For General Adm1n1strat1on. (a) Begun by writ. The proceedings in such actions are divided into three parts: --(i) The proceedings up to judgment; (ii) The proceedings conducted in chambers by the master1, consequential on the judgment; (iii) The proceedings in Court on further consideration. (i) The proceedings up to judgment. Any person interested in the due administration of the estate, e.g. a creditor or a legatee, can bring an action to have the estate administered by the Court. The first step is to issue a writ, claiming this, against the executor or administrator2. The defendant then appears. The plaintiff issues his statement of claim; the defendant issues his defence; the plaintiff replies usually by joining issue on the defence 3. 1 Formerly called Chief Clerks. 2 App. II. A. 3 App. II. B. The evidence is usually given by way of affidavit; but unless the parties agree to do this the evidence is given orally. All witnesses, however, who have made affidavits are liable to be cross-examined upon them. Excerpt from Principles of the Law of Succession to Deceased Persons The present treatise is an attempt to solve, so far as regards elementary English law, the problem which has been thus concisely stated - "What becomes of the rights and obligations of a person when that person dies?" (Markby's Elements of Law, section 773.) My object has been to place before the student, in a connected and systematic form, the leading principles of English law on this important subject. In dealing with rights and obligations in general, and pointing out those which are capable of passing by succession, I have availed myself, as far as possible, of the classifications of private rights and obligations contained in Professor Holland's work on Jurisprudence. By adopting them I have been enabled to state concisely, and, I hope, clearly and with some degree of completeness, the effect of a person's death upon his various legal relations. Launching a major new research project examining the principles of succession law in comparative perspective, this book discusses the formalities which the law imposes in order for a person to make a testamentary disposal of property. Among the questions considered are the following. How are wills made? What precisely are the rules - as to the signature of the testator, the use of witnesses, the need for a notary public or lawyer, and so on? Is there is a choice of will-type and, if so, which type is used most often and what are the advantages and disadvantages of each? How common is will-making or do most people die intestate? What happens if formalities are not observed? How can requirements of form be explained and justified? How did the law develop historically, what is the state of the law today, and what are the prospects for the future? The focus is on Europe, and on countries which have been influenced by the European experience. Thus in addition to giving a detailed treatment of the law in Austria, Belgium, England and Wales, France, Germany, Hungary, Italy, the Netherlands, Poland, and Spain, the book explores legal developments in Australia, New Zealand, the United States of America, and in some of the countries of Latin America with a particular emphasis on Brazil. It also includes chapters on two of the mixed jurisdictions - Scotland and South Africa - and on Islamic Law. The book opens with chapters on Roman law and on the early modern law in Europe, thus setting the historical scene as well as anticipating and complementing the accounts of national history which appear in subsequent chapters; and it concludes with an assessment of the overall development of the law in the countries surveyed, and with some wider reflections on the nature and purpose of testamentary formalities.
